NYC Bidet Billboard Suit: Bare Derrières!

Posted Jul 10, 2007, 07:14 pm CST
By Martha Neil

In New York City's traditionally seamy Times Square, a church is claiming that a billboard featuring bare derrières emblazoned with smiley faces violates indecency standards in the cleaned-up midtown Manhattan neighborhood.

And, for the moment, at least, a judge has agreed, issuing a temporary restraining order barring the two-story bidet billboard from being installed on the building in which the church is located, reports the New York Times.

The suit was filed by the interdenominational Times Square Church against the building's landlord and the billboard sign company.
